用python如何判断整形

用python如何判断整形

作者:Rhett Bai发布时间:2026-01-06阅读时长:0 分钟阅读次数:14

用户关注问题

Q
如何使用Python验证一个变量是否为整型?

在Python中,怎样判断一个变量的类型是否为整型?

A

通过内置函数检查变量类型

可以使用内置函数 isinstance() 来判断变量是否为整型。语法为 isinstance(变量, int),当变量是整数类型时返回True,否则返回False。

Q
如何判断字符串是否可以转换为整数?

如果有一个字符串,想判断它是否能转换为整数类型,该如何操作?

A

尝试转换并捕获异常的方法

可以尝试用 int() 函数将字符串转换为整数,然后通过异常处理捕获转换失败的情况。如果转换没有出现 ValueError,说明该字符串可以表示一个整数。

Q
判断某个数字类型是否为整型有哪些常见误区?

在判定变量类型是整数时,哪些问题容易被忽视?

A

浮点数与整数的区别及类型判断

有些数字虽然表现为整数形式(如3.0),但其类型是浮点数,因此用 isinstance(3.0, int) 会返回False。需要明确判断变量的数据类型或先将其转换为整型,再进行处理。